What Are Photorealistic Renderings?
Photorealistic renderings are digitally created images that closely resemble real photographs. Using advanced 3D modeling and rendering software, artists recreate objects, products, or spaces with precise attention to detail. Every element from surface texture and reflections to lighting and shadows is carefully crafted to simulate how it would appear in real life.
The process usually begins with a 3D model based on drawings, plans, or design concepts. Materials and textures are applied, followed by lighting that mimics natural or artificial sources. The final rendering is then refined through post-processing to achieve a balanced and lifelike result.

Key Elements That Create Photorealism
Achieving photorealism requires a combination of technical precision and artistic skill. The way light interacts with surfaces determines depth, mood, and realism. Accurate lighting setups replicate sunlight, artificial lighting, and even subtle reflections from surrounding objects.
Materials and textures also play a vital role. Wood grain, fabric weave, metal finishes, glass transparency, and stone surfaces must look authentic at close range. High-resolution textures and accurate material settings help achieve this level of detail.
Camera angles and composition further enhance realism. Just like photography, the choice of perspective, framing, and focus influences how natural the image appears.
Applications Across Different Industries
Photorealistic renderings are widely used in architecture and real estate. Architects use them to visualize buildings and interiors before construction begins, while developers rely on them for marketing and sales presentations. These visuals help potential buyers imagine the finished space with ease.
In interior design, photorealistic renderings allow designers to present complete room concepts, including furniture, lighting, and décor. Clients can see how colors, materials, and layouts work together, making it easier to finalize decisions.
Product manufacturers and e-commerce brands also benefit greatly. Photorealistic product renderings showcase items in detail without the need for physical prototypes or photoshoots. Furniture, electronics, and consumer goods can be displayed in multiple variations and environments.
Benefits of Using Photorealistic Renderings
One major benefit is cost efficiency. Creating physical samples or staging real locations can be expensive. Photorealistic renderings eliminate many of these costs while offering complete creative control.
Flexibility is another advantage. Changes to design elements, materials, or lighting can be made quickly without repeating the entire process. This allows designers and businesses to respond easily to feedback.
Photorealistic renderings also improve marketing effectiveness. High-quality visuals attract attention, increase engagement, and create a strong first impression across websites, advertisements, and social media platforms.
